The Company

Breton Communications is the top media and resource provider in the Canadian vision care industry. Established in 1995, it is well-known for the quality, innovation and relevance of its products and publications. The company’s print and digital subscriber base reaches over 20,000 eyecare professionals, optical retailers and suppliers.

During its 20-year history, Breton Communications has expanded on its role as a trade magazine publisher and now offers print and digital magazines in both French and English, an electronic news bulletin and multiple web sites including an online optical directory as well as a vision care employment portal.

From the latest product developments, fashion trends and medical information to recruiting services, optical market research and Canada’s premier industry search engine, Breton Communications is the leading single source of information for Canadian eyecare stakeholders.

Evolution

1995 – Breton Communications is officially launched and henceforth secures former publisher Publiédition’s data base and contract for Opti-Guide Canadian Optical Supplier Directory as well as Coup d’oeil magazine.

1997 – Mandated to produce the Opticians Association of Canada publications, Vision Magazine and La Revue.

2004 – Launches www.Opti-Guide.com, the online version of Opti-Guide Canadian Optical Suppliers Guide.

2004 – Establishes a bi-weekly electronic news bulletin, Opti-News.

2005 – Initiates Opti-Promo, an email marketing resource.

2009 – Complete redesign of www.Opti-Guide.com with increased functionality and a more user-friendly interface.

2011 – Develops Envision: seeing beyond and EnVue : voir plus loin, independent vision care trade magazines and the first in the country to be distributed in digital format.

2012 – Breton Communications is named a finalist in the annual Dunamis Competition held by the Laval Chamber of Commerce. The company was recognized in the category of Service Provider – up to 15 employees.

2012 – Creates Breton-Stats, a market research tool, and distributes the first-ever survey of Canadian eyecare professionals.

2013Envision: seeing beyond magazine successfully completes its first Alliance for Audited Media (AAM) audit and qualifies for membership.

2014 – Launches www.BretonJobs.com, a bilingual niche website designed to facilitate the recruiting process for Canadian optical employers and job seekers.

2014 – Implements new Opti-Promo email marketing platform in accordance with Canadian Anti-Spam Law C-28.

2015 – Employment portal www.BretonJobs.com successfully partners with multiple industry organizations and becomes a preferred vendor for several optical buying groups.
